4. For starters, at least as of July, 2005, she still works for the CIA.
And, if she plans to take legal action in a civil court, she'd be wise to say nothing.

Here's a link to the July 18, 2005 "Open Letter" to the Congressional Leadership from members of the intelligence community:

http://www.crooksandliars.com/stories/2005/07/19/ciaAgentsLetterToUsSenateAndHouse.html

And, here is the relevant segment of text:

In the case of Valerie Plame, she still works for the CIA and is not in a position to publicly defend her reputation and honor. We stand in her stead and ask that Republicans and Democrats honor her service to her country and stop the campaign of disparagement and innuendo aimed at discrediting Mrs. Wilson and her husband.
